Union Bank of Australia, one pound, Goulburn, 4th Jnry 1858 No. C/T 9841 (MVR type 2a). A full note printed on thin paper, nearly fine and extremely rare as an issued country town note.

The Union Bank of Australia Limited, one pound, Sydney, 2nd Jany. 1899, 2/A 812648 (MVR 2). Original body, some staining, otherwise good fine and rare.

Union Bank of Australia, black and white uniface printer's proof on paper, one pound, Melbourne, 1st Jany.186-, imprint of Perkins, Bacon & Co London, Patent Hardened Steel Plate, pencilled 'All the £1 notes to be dated as this 1st Jany 186' at top and 'March 1860' at signature reserve (MVR 2a). Remnants of glue stains on back and front, otherwise good extremely fine.

The Union Bank of Australia Limited, ten pounds, altered as a fraud from a one pound, Sydney, 1st Jan 1897, 2/A 719332 (MVR 1c). Perforation horizontally in the centre, large tear and repair, thin paper, frayed edges but full note, thinned areas on the back, signature left on back GDM/17/3/09, poor - fair but very rare.

Western Australian Bank, one pound, Perth, Jan 1844 No -, unissued form on unwatermarked paper (MVR p235, fig 241, and Pedigrees p262). Uncirculated.

Government of New South Wales, (Sydney), Treasury note, one pound, uniface, undated (c1893), No.23409, imprint of 'Sydney: Charles Potter, Government Printer' (MVR fig196, p186). Folds and creases, pin hole top left corner, good fine and extremely rare.
